With my previous Asura model attempt I definitely struggled with posing the model because of Asura proportions. They have very big heads, which makes a lot of poses and angles seem odd! They have very short legs, so kneeling can look awkward. Their torsos are very long, and the arms have strange proportions too, like the forearms seem to be quite a bit longer than the upper arm, and the forearm is also so thick. Having these in mind, as well as personal preference is some of what led me to Tekki's current proportions. But even with those odd proportions, I decided to go with an Asura model first because I thought it would be easier than a Sylvari! The proportions might require some adjustment during the rigging stage, but at least the topology is straightforward! Sylvari have more human proportions, but those plant shapes were really intimidating, I worried that while trying to keep a topology that holds those unique shapes of their leaves, I would end up messing up the topology required for good deformations. As for Charr.. I think their muscular build might be a little tricky, but I also think there is a lot of research and material that covers muscular characters so it should be ok? I think for Charr I would be more worried about posing their hands [with those big claws! It's already tricky to draw] and making them talk or kiss [with those big fangs!]. The other biggest thing that intimidates me is how to handle their fur! My computer is not powerful, I don't even have a graphics card lol, so I can't use real particle effects/real fur.
